In this role, you will collaborate within a dynamic Public Health Nursing team, guiding advocacy and health education programs. You will be responsible for immunization delivery, disease prevention, and comprehensive assessments. Your leadership will address social health determinants, ensuring equality in service provision while maintaining rigorous documentation.
Key Responsibilities:
• Evaluate and enhance health promotion initiatives
• Lead the planning and delivery of health programs
• Conduct preventive screenings and health assessments
• Engage with community and interdisciplinary partners
• Maintain high documentation standards according to nursing conventions
Requirements:
• Completion of an accredited nursing program
• Active registration with the College of Registered Nurses of Alberta
• 3 years of recent public health nursing experience
• Basic Cardiac Life Support certification
• Access to a vehicle and valid Driver’s License
